## Build Provenance: QuickSeek Index

If autocomplete feels sluggish, it's usually because the QuickSeek index was built from a stale snapshot. We stamp every index build with provenance metadata so you can trace exactly which commit and dataset produced it. New folks: always check provenance before filing a perf bug — half the time it's just an old index. The current verified build token appears below.

pipeline stamp: htk9_ce63042d9

**Mgmt Meeting Minutes — Retiring the Brightline Range**

Quick recap for sales leads at Fenholt Supplies: we agreed to retire the Brightline fixture range by year-end. Remaining stock moves to clearance pricing next month, and accounts on standing orders get migrated to the Lumetta range. Trade-in incentives were approved in principle. The confidential note on next steps sits just below.

board note of bajof-bajeg: The pricing group signed off on a budget of $13.4 million for Project Sildor. The renewal with Lamixek Holdings closes at $48.9 million a year, 49 percent above the last contract.

Action item (Wavecrumb preview outage): the waveform renderer still chews unbounded memory on files over 90 minutes — we capped it with a hard timeout, but that's a band-aid. Someone should own the streaming-decode rewrite this quarter. Background, profiling traces, and the proposed design are gathered on the internal page here.

runbook for tafof-yawif: https://confluence.tolvaqsys.internal/display/display/browse/pages/7be3

Internal Memo — Finance Team

Subject: Potential acquisition of Quillbarrow Analytics

We have begun preliminary diligence on Quillbarrow Analytics. Indicative price is 3.2x trailing revenue, funded from reserves. Their Lanterhithe office would fold into our Dunmore operation. Modelling owners: treasury and tax. Keep all workings off shared drives until diligence closes. The strategic logic is summarised in the note below.

management briefing: Project Ulavan slips by two quarters because of the staffing delay.